Add 90/84 and 8/35
1st number: 1 6/84, 2nd number: 8/35
90/84 + 8/35 is 13/10.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 84 and 35 is 420
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 420 - For the 1st fraction, since 84 × 5 = 420,
90/84 = 90 × 5/84 × 5 = 450/420 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 35 × 12 = 420,
8/35 = 8 × 12/35 × 12 = 96/420 - Add the two like fractions:
450/420 + 96/420 = 450 + 96/420 = 546/420 - 546/420 simplified gives 13/10
- So, 90/84 + 8/35 = 13/10
